Inflammation of the tonsils happens when the tonsils are irritated. It is usually caused by bacteria like group A streptococcus. Children, teens, and young adults are often affected by young adults and typically presents with symptoms such as difficulty swallowing, fever, earaches, and swollen glands.

To identify tonsillitis, your doctor may by taking a look at the tonsils and through the use of a swab test to ensure it is bacterial. To treat viral cases, the focus is on pain relief through painkillers. When bacteria are the cause, antibiotics might be used.

When tonsillitis persists, a tonsillectomy may be necessary if there are multiple severe episodes. Preventative measures include good hygiene practices.

Tonsillitis is primarily caused by viral or bacterial infections, with treatment ranging from self-care to antibiotics.
